How are Scrambled egg and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al different?

  • Scrambled egg is higher in Choline, however,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al is richer in Vitamin B12, Vitamin B6, Vitamin B3, Vitamin B1, Folate, Vitamin B2, Manganese, and Vitamin A RAE.
  • Daily need coverage for Vitamin B12 from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al is 191% higher.

Fast foods, egg, scrambled and Cereals ready-to-eat, KELLOGG, KELLOGG'S HONEY SMACKS are the varieties used in this article.

All nutrients comparison - raw data values

Nutrient Scrambled egg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al Opinion
Net carbs 2.08g 83.5g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Protein 13.84g 5.7g Scrambled egg
Fats 16.18g 2.2g Scrambled egg
Carbs 2.08g 88.5g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Calories 212kcal 380kcal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Sugar 1.64g 56.2g Scrambled egg
Fiber 0g 5g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Calcium 57mg 14mg Scrambled egg
Iron 2.59mg 1.5mg Scrambled egg
Magnesium 14mg 59mg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Phosphorus 242mg 213mg Scrambled egg
Potassium 147mg 183mg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Sodium 187mg 142mg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Zinc 1.66mg 1.7mg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Copper 0.067mg 0.195mg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Manganese 0.043mg 1.895mg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Selenium 22.5µg 29.1µg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Vitamin A 679IU 1852IU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Vitamin A RAE 176µg 556µg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Vitamin E 0.96mg 0.41mg Scrambled egg
Vitamin D 46IU 148IU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Vitamin D 1.1µg 3.7µg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Vitamin C 3.3mg 22mg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Vitamin B1 0.08mg 1.39mg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Vitamin B2 0.52mg 1.57mg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Vitamin B3 0.21mg 18.5mg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Vitamin B5 0.94mg Scrambled egg
Vitamin B6 0.19mg 1.85mg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Folate 29µg 370µg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Vitamin B12 1.01µg 5.6µg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Vitamin K 9µg 2.8µg Scrambled egg
Tryptophan 0.212mg Scrambled egg
Threonine 0.657mg Scrambled egg
Isoleucine 0.836mg Scrambled egg
Leucine 1.185mg Scrambled egg
Lysine 0.913mg Scrambled egg
Methionine 0.427mg Scrambled egg
Phenylalanine 0.75mg Scrambled egg
Valine 0.96mg Scrambled egg
Histidine 0.325mg Scrambled egg
Cholesterol 426mg 0mg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Trans Fat 0.5g Scrambled egg
Saturated Fat 6.153g 0.5g Kellogg's Honey Smacks Cereal
Monounsaturated Fat 5.889g 0.4g Scrambled egg
Polyunsaturated fat 1.969g 0.5g Scrambled egg
